Details
-
Improvement
-
Resolution: Fixed
-
Critical
-
6.0.0
-
4
-
Build Team 2018 Sprint 24, Build Team 2018 Sprint 26, Build Team 2019 Sprint 1, Build Team 2019 Sprint 2
Description
As per the upgrade matrix for Alice, direct upgrade from 4.x to 6.0 is not supported. But currently, it does work. Upgrade from 4.x to 6.0 should be blocked.
Upgrade Matrix
https://docs.google.com/document/d/15YHt3xdIoL4vc16j2cAquUN0M6gWsabYMIXEog0Dnlo/edit?ts=5b5a3e90
Upgrade console output from 4.6.5 -> 6.0
rpm -U couchbase-server-enterprise-6.0.0-1614-centos6.x86_64.rpm | tee upgrade.log
|
Stopping couchbase-server
|
[ OK ]
|
Minimum RAM required : 4 GB
|
System RAM configured : 3.79 GB
|
|
Minimum number of processors required : 4 cores
|
Number of processors on the system : 4 cores
|
|
warning: /opt/couchbase/etc/couchdb/local.ini saved as /opt/couchbase/etc/couchdb/local.ini.rpmsave
|
warning: /opt/couchbase/var/lib/couchbase/config/config.dat saved as /opt/couchbase/var/lib/couchbase/config/config.dat.rpmsave
|
Upgrading couchbase-server ...
|
/opt/couchbase/bin/install/cbupgrade -c /opt/couchbase/var/lib/couchbase/config -a yes
|
Automatic mode: running without interactive questions or confirmations.
|
Analysing...
|
Previous config.dat file is /opt/couchbase/var/lib/couchbase/config/config.dat.rpmsave
|
Target node: ns_1@127.0.0.1
|
Upgrading from 2.0
|
|
Couchbase should not be running.
|
Please use: /etc/init.d/couchbase-server stop
|
|
Database dir: /opt/couchbase/var/lib/couchbase/data
|
|
Buckets to upgrade: beer-sample,gamesim-sample,travel-sample
|
|
Checking disk space available for buckets in directory:
|
/opt/couchbase/var/lib/couchbase/data
|
Free disk bucket space wanted: 0.0
|
Free disk bucket space available: 31250513920
|
Free disk space factor: 2.0
|
Ok.
|
|
Analysis complete.
|
|
Copying /opt/couchbase/var/lib/couchbase/config/config.dat.rpmsave
|
cp /opt/couchbase/var/lib/couchbase/config/config.dat.rpmsave /opt/couchbase/bin/install/../../var/lib/couchbase/config/config.dat
|
Ensuring bucket data directories.
|
Ensuring bucket data directory: /opt/couchbase/var/lib/couchbase/data/beer-sample
|
mkdir -p /opt/couchbase/var/lib/couchbase/data/beer-sample
|
Ensuring bucket data directory: /opt/couchbase/var/lib/couchbase/data/gamesim-sample
|
mkdir -p /opt/couchbase/var/lib/couchbase/data/gamesim-sample
|
Ensuring bucket data directory: /opt/couchbase/var/lib/couchbase/data/travel-sample
|
mkdir -p /opt/couchbase/var/lib/couchbase/data/travel-sample
|
Ensuring dbdir owner/group: /opt/couchbase/var/lib/couchbase/data
|
chown -R couchbase:couchbase /opt/couchbase/var/lib/couchbase/data
|
Ensuring dbdir owner/group: /opt/couchbase/var/lib/couchbase/data
|
chown -R couchbase:couchbase /opt/couchbase/var/lib/couchbase/data
|
|
Done.
|
Starting couchbase-server
|
[ OK ]
|
|
You have successfully installed Couchbase Server.
|
Please browse to http://centos-64-x64:8091/ to configure your server.
|
Please refer to http://couchbase.com for additional resources.
|
|
Please note that you have to update your firewall configuration to
|
allow connections to the following ports:
|
4369, 8091 to 8094, 9100 to 9105, 9998, 9999, 11207, 11209 to 11211,
|
11214, 11215, 18091 to 18093, and from 21100 to 21299.
|
|
By using this software you agree to the End User License Agreement.
|
See /opt/couchbase/LICENSE.txt.
|
|
Attachments
Issue Links
- mentioned in
-
Page Loading...
For Gerrit Dashboard: MB-31244 | ||||||
---|---|---|---|---|---|---|
# | Subject | Branch | Project | Status | CR | V |
114932,2 | MB-31244: Prevent upgrade from >1 major version ago | master | voltron | Status: MERGED | +2 | +1 |